A wave is described by its wavelength (or the distance between two sequential crests or two sequential troughs), the wave period (or the time it takes a wave to travel the wavelength), and the wave frequency (the number of wave crests that pass by a fixed location in a given amount of time). In general, in the southern Mediterranean, currents typically flow from west to east, in the north they flow from east to west, and in the middle of the Mediterranean, currents move in eddies that can be hundreds of kilometres long. Shallow areas in otherwise open water can experience rotary tidal currents, flowing in directions that continually change and thus the flow direction (not the flow) completes a full rotation in 12+12 hours (for example, the Nantucket Shoals).[75]. The Mediterranean Sea is then divided into smaller units between the French Riviera and Corsica is the Ligurian Sea; the Adriatic Sea is bounded by the shores of Albania, Bosnia and Herzegovina, Croatia, Italy, Montenegro, and Slovenia; between Greece and southern Italy is the Ionian Sea; the Cretan Sea bathes the shores of Crete and peninsular Greece; and the body of water between Turkey and Greece is called the Aegean Sea.
